package com.dsh.other.mapper;
|
|
import com.baomidou.mybatisplus.core.mapper.BaseMapper;
|
import com.dsh.other.entity.SiteBooking;
|
import com.dsh.other.model.BillingRequestOfType;
|
import com.dsh.other.model.SiteBookingQuery;
|
import org.apache.ibatis.annotations.Param;
|
|
import java.math.BigDecimal;
|
import java.util.List;
|
|
/**
|
* @author zhibing.pu
|
* @date 2023/7/13 16:48
|
*/
|
public interface SiteBookingMapper extends BaseMapper<SiteBooking> {
|
List<BillingRequestOfType> queryDatas(@Param("appUserId")Integer appUserId,@Param("monthStart") String monthStart,@Param("monthEnd") String monthEnd);
|
|
List<SiteBooking> listAll(@Param("query")SiteBookingQuery query, @Param("sTime")String sTime, @Param("eTime")String eTime, @Param("amount") BigDecimal amount);
|
|
Integer queryByCode(String code);
|
}
|